E - Edge Sharpen

An edge sharpen filter cleans up the edges of an image, making it look
cleaner and sharper. While edge sharpening does make the image look
cleaner, it also removes some fine detail from the original image. The
strength of the edge sharpen filter can be entered from 1 to 24. Entering a
23E gives the sharpest edges, but also increases noise in the image.

0E Don’t sharpen image

(default)

14E Apply edge sharpen for typical image

ne Apply edge sharpen using strength n (n = 1-24)

F - File Format

Indicates the desired format for the image.

0F KIM format

1F TIFF binary

2F TIFF binary group 4, compressed

3F TIFF grayscale

4F Uncompressed binary (upper left to lower right, 1 pixel/bit, 0

padded end of line)

5F Uncompressed grayscale (upper left to lower right, bitmap format)

6F JPEG image

(default)

8F BMP format (lower right to upper left, uncompressed)
